神州浩天鴻蒙開(kāi)發(fā)面試題是眾多IT人士所關(guān)注的話(huà)題之一。這個(gè)面試題主要考察應(yīng)聘者對(duì)鴻蒙操作系統(tǒng)的理解和開(kāi)發(fā)能力。鴻蒙操作系統(tǒng)是華為公司自主研發(fā)的一款全場(chǎng)景智能終端操作系統(tǒng),它具有分布式架構(gòu)、多設(shè)備協(xié)同、安全可靠等特點(diǎn),被譽(yù)為未來(lái)操作系統(tǒng)的代表之一。那么,關(guān)于神州浩天鴻蒙開(kāi)發(fā)面試題,我們需要了解哪些內(nèi)容呢?
一、神州浩天鴻蒙開(kāi)發(fā)面試題內(nèi)容
神州浩天鴻蒙開(kāi)發(fā)面試題主要包括以下幾個(gè)方面:
1.鴻蒙操作系統(tǒng)的基本概念和架構(gòu)
2.鴻蒙操作系統(tǒng)的應(yīng)用場(chǎng)景和優(yōu)勢(shì)
3.鴻蒙操作系統(tǒng)的開(kāi)發(fā)工具和開(kāi)發(fā)語(yǔ)言
4.鴻蒙操作系統(tǒng)的應(yīng)用開(kāi)發(fā)和調(diào)試方法
5.鴻蒙操作系統(tǒng)的安全機(jī)制和安全開(kāi)發(fā)規(guī)范
二、神州浩天鴻蒙開(kāi)發(fā)面試題答案解析
1.鴻蒙操作系統(tǒng)的基本概念和架構(gòu)
鴻蒙操作系統(tǒng)是一款面向全場(chǎng)景智能終端的操作系統(tǒng),它采用了分布式架構(gòu),可以實(shí)現(xiàn)多設(shè)備協(xié)同,具有高效、安全、可靠等特點(diǎn)。鴻蒙操作系統(tǒng)的核心是分布式軟總線(xiàn)技術(shù),它可以將不同設(shè)備之間的資源整合起來(lái),實(shí)現(xiàn)數(shù)據(jù)共享和協(xié)同處理。鴻蒙操作系統(tǒng)也支持多種設(shè)備接入,包括手機(jī)、電視、汽車(chē)、智能家居等。
2.鴻蒙操作系統(tǒng)的應(yīng)用場(chǎng)景和優(yōu)勢(shì)
鴻蒙操作系統(tǒng)的應(yīng)用場(chǎng)景非常廣泛,可以應(yīng)用于手機(jī)、平板電腦、智能電視、智能音箱、智能手表、智能家居等多個(gè)領(lǐng)域。鴻蒙操作系統(tǒng)的優(yōu)勢(shì)主要包括以下幾個(gè)方面:
(1)分布式架構(gòu):可以實(shí)現(xiàn)多設(shè)備協(xié)同,提高資源利用率和處理效率。
(2)多設(shè)備接入:支持多種設(shè)備接入,可以實(shí)現(xiàn)全場(chǎng)景智能化。
(3)安全可靠:采用了多種安全機(jī)制,保障用戶(hù)隱私和數(shù)據(jù)安全。
(4)開(kāi)發(fā)便捷:提供了豐富的開(kāi)發(fā)工具和開(kāi)發(fā)語(yǔ)言,降低了開(kāi)發(fā)門(mén)檻。
3.鴻蒙操作系統(tǒng)的開(kāi)發(fā)工具和開(kāi)發(fā)語(yǔ)言
鴻蒙操作系統(tǒng)的開(kāi)發(fā)工具主要包括DevEco Studio和HBuilder,其中DevEco Studio是華為公司自主研發(fā)的一款集成開(kāi)發(fā)環(huán)境,支持多種開(kāi)發(fā)語(yǔ)言和開(kāi)發(fā)框架。鴻蒙操作系統(tǒng)的開(kāi)發(fā)語(yǔ)言主要包括Java、C、C++、JS等多種語(yǔ)言,同時(shí)也支持多種開(kāi)發(fā)框架,包括Lite、ACE、HiACE等。
4.鴻蒙操作系統(tǒng)的應(yīng)用開(kāi)發(fā)和調(diào)試方法
鴻蒙操作系統(tǒng)的應(yīng)用開(kāi)發(fā)主要包括以下幾個(gè)步驟:
(1)創(chuàng)建應(yīng)用:使用開(kāi)發(fā)工具創(chuàng)建一個(gè)新的應(yīng)用項(xiàng)目。
(2)編寫(xiě)代碼:根據(jù)需求編寫(xiě)應(yīng)用代碼。
(3)構(gòu)建應(yīng)用:使用開(kāi)發(fā)工具構(gòu)建應(yīng)用,并生成安裝包。
(4)安裝應(yīng)用:將應(yīng)用安裝到目標(biāo)設(shè)備上。
鴻蒙操作系統(tǒng)的調(diào)試方法主要包括以下幾個(gè)方面:
(1)日志調(diào)試:通過(guò)查看日志信息,分析應(yīng)用運(yùn)行時(shí)出現(xiàn)的問(wèn)題。
(2)調(diào)試工具:使用開(kāi)發(fā)工具提供的調(diào)試工具,對(duì)應(yīng)用進(jìn)行調(diào)試。
(3)模擬器調(diào)試:使用模擬器對(duì)應(yīng)用進(jìn)行調(diào)試,模擬不同設(shè)備的運(yùn)行環(huán)境。
5.鴻蒙操作系統(tǒng)的安全機(jī)制和安全開(kāi)發(fā)規(guī)范
鴻蒙操作系統(tǒng)的安全機(jī)制主要包括以下幾個(gè)方面:
(1)安全啟動(dòng):在啟動(dòng)過(guò)程中對(duì)系統(tǒng)進(jìn)行安全驗(yàn)證,防止惡意代碼攻擊。
(2)安全通信:采用加密算法對(duì)通信數(shù)據(jù)進(jìn)行加密,保障數(shù)據(jù)安全。
(3)安全存儲(chǔ):采用加密算法對(duì)存儲(chǔ)數(shù)據(jù)進(jìn)行加密,防止數(shù)據(jù)泄露。
(4)權(quán)限管理:對(duì)用戶(hù)權(quán)限進(jìn)行管理,防止惡意程序獲取用戶(hù)權(quán)限。
鴻蒙操作系統(tǒng)的安全開(kāi)發(fā)規(guī)范主要包括以下幾個(gè)方面:
(1)代碼審查:對(duì)開(kāi)發(fā)過(guò)程中的代碼進(jìn)行嚴(yán)格審查,防止存在漏洞。
(2)安全測(cè)試:對(duì)應(yīng)用進(jìn)行全面的安全測(cè)試,發(fā)現(xiàn)并修復(fù)安全漏洞。
(3)安全培訓(xùn):對(duì)開(kāi)發(fā)人員進(jìn)行安全培訓(xùn),提高安全意識(shí)和技能。
(4)安全更新:及時(shí)對(duì)已經(jīng)發(fā)現(xiàn)的安全漏洞進(jìn)行修復(fù),保障用戶(hù)安全。
三、
神州浩天鴻蒙開(kāi)發(fā)面試題是一個(gè)比較重要的面試題目,它涉及到鴻蒙操作系統(tǒng)的多個(gè)方面,需要考生具備較強(qiáng)的開(kāi)發(fā)能力和理解能力。鴻蒙操作系統(tǒng)也是未來(lái)操作系統(tǒng)的代表之一,對(duì)于IT從業(yè)人員來(lái)說(shuō),學(xué)習(xí)和掌握鴻蒙操作系統(tǒng)的開(kāi)發(fā)技術(shù)非常重要。